Il 26/03/2020 00:14, Heiko Stuebner ha scritto:
> From: Giulio Benetti <giulio.benetti@micronovasrl.com>
>
> Some 8250 ports have a TEMT interrupt but it's not a part of the 8250
> standard, instead only available on some implementations.
>
> The current em485 implementation does not work on ports without it.
> The only chance to make it work is to loop-read on LSR register.
>
> So add UART_CAP_TEMT to mark 8250 uarts having this interrupt,
> update all current em485 users with that capability and make
> the stop_tx function loop-read on uarts not having it.
>
> Signed-off-by: Giulio Benetti <giulio.benetti@micronovasrl.com>
> [moved to use added UART_CAP_TEMT, use readx_poll_timeout]
> Signed-off-by: Heiko Stuebner <heiko.stuebner@theobroma-systems.com>

> @@ -225,6 +225,8 @@ static int of_platform_serial_probe(struct platform_device *ofdev)
> &port8250.overrun_backoff_time_ms) != 0)
> port8250.overrun_backoff_time_ms = 0;
>
> + port8250.capabilities |= UART_CAP_TEMT;
> +
Shouldn't this be NOT UART_CAP_TEMT set by default? On all other
vendor specific files you enable it, I think here you shouldn't enable
it too by default. Right?
